Transaction 8ebacf522f7352f17d0177b614223a2f53b54df77442612dde5710d199a0a856
1 Input
1 Output
-
8ebacf522f7352f17d0177b614223a2f53b54df77442612dde5710d199a0a856:0
- value
- 90309
- script pubkey
- OP_0 OP_PUSHBYTES_20 492457957fcfeab76ef98eaa639ff655e60e8bfc
- address
- bc1qfyj909tlel4twmhe364x88lk2hnqazlutgzxmt